摘要
Linear relationships between (s)(s)pK(a) values in acetonitrile-water mixtures and (w)(w)pK(a), values in pure water have been established for five families of compounds: aliphatic carboxylic acids, aromatic carboxylic acids, phenols, amines, and pyridines. The parameters (slope and intercept) of the linear correlations have been related with acetonitrile-water composition, The proposed equations allow accurate estimation of the pK(a) values of any member of the studied families at any acetonitrile-water composition up to 60% of acetonitrile in volume (100% for pyridines). Conversely, the same equations can be used to estimate aqueous pK(a) values from chromatographic pK(a) values obtained from any acetonitrile-water mobile phase between the composition range studied. Estimation of pK(a) values have been tested with chromatographic literature data. (C) 2002 Elsevier Science B.V. All rights reserved.
